Golden Bear expands team with new hires

Published on: 5th April 2022

The appointments come following the company’s recent sales growth as it invests further into its sales and marketing capabilities and design facilities.

Golden Bear has announced the appointment of five new hires across its sales, marketing and creative departments.

Caroline Martin and Jonathan Williams have been appointed to the roles of senior brand manager and national account manager respectively. Caroline will work closely with the brand team to implement and progress processes and strategies to best support new product development based on consumer insight and trend research. She brings to the role 20 years of leading product and brand abilities with diverse, cross-sector experience and a strong record of change and transformation management. Jonathan will lead the management and growth of the company’s major UK retailer accounts. He comes equipped with 20 years’ experience in sales, 10 of which have been for major accounts, and having worked with market leading global brands.

In addition, Kate Goss joins the business as creative manager, Heather Preece as graphics designer, and Niamh Beer as digital marketing coordinator. As a creative team leader with strong commercial acumen, Kate will be maximising the team’s output, overseeing asset creation, design and management for all areas of the business. In turn, Heather will be working alongside Kate to create engaging, innovative artwork, packaging, style guides and presentations, helping to shape the visual presence of Golden Bear’s brands for the digital and physical marketplace. Niamh joins the growing digital marketing department, where she will focus on driving sales via owned online channels – and those of retail partners – while also developing the company’s website, virtual sales tools and social media platforms.

Commenting on the appointments, Barry Hughes, managing director, Golden Bear Toys said: “It’s a fantastic time to be joining Golden Bear. We’re experiencing a period of growth in an evolving business, seeing vast innovation throughout our brand extensions and an ongoing commitment to the development of new and exciting products and properties. I’m delighted to be welcoming each of our new members to the team.”
